Output 897de656e8d5d3e70fc007c9b7af06de738ef7ed70e2e6c3e84163ddb51aa19a:1

value
17240329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646d6c88f84c60f416c57315af7ca71f26e13a15 OP_EQUAL
address
3Ar2aduhUyF7fuQCVbcpoyNKacTBPzsbk7
transaction
897de656e8d5d3e70fc007c9b7af06de738ef7ed70e2e6c3e84163ddb51aa19a
confirmations
455900
spent
true